Character of the water

Sandsjön lies in the cold north — a northern clear oligotrophic forest lake. The water is crystal-clear and the fish skittish in the sharp light. In summer a thermocline settles around 5 m and splits the lake into two worlds.

The surroundings

The lake lies half-remote, a fair way from the nearest road, tucked into woodland.

Moderately deep (12 m) — shallow bays, the odd reef and a deeper channel through the middle.

Permits & rules

Fishing permit required — Sandsjön FVOF. Day permit ~140 kr · annual permit ~700 kr.

  • Pike: keep at most one over 75 cm per day.
  •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.
